I am using a Brother MFC8850 connected wirelessly. I had to purchase the second tray separately.

You’ll need to set up your print settings properly to print multisized docs from the correct trays. Brother Tech support is great for that. They can even remote in to your computer to set it up for you.

Caveat: Printing mixed doc sizes to this printer from a Mac system did not work for me. I ended up getting a second hand PC laptop to act as my print server.
